huge source of strength and motivation for me to complete this graduation paper, and for that I’m forever grateful i ABSTRACT This study investigated the use of four sentence types (simple, compound, complex and compound-complex) and three dependent clause types (nominal, adverbial and adjectival) 87 VSTEP Task essays were collected from sophomore students of FELTE, ULIS, VNU The essays were analyzed to gain insight into the most and least frequently used sentence types and clause types by students as well as the errors they made while writing those types The results reveal that complex sentences were the most frequently used sentence types by students, while compound sentences were the least popular Regarding dependent clause types, all nominal, adverbial and adjectival clauses were found in students’ writings The findings of this study also showed that though the students were English majors, they made several errors related to linking devices when forming more complicated sentences and encountered confusion while using restrictive and non-restrictive adjectival clauses Pedagogical implications and suggestions were also provided to help teachers of English improve their students’ writing proficiency and learners of English, especially future VSTEP test-takers achieve their desired score in the test Keywords: VSTEP, writing, simple sentences, compound sentences,
